“As Goddess, I am not actually supposed to help you. But you are special.”

 

“I am honored.”

 

“The first thing we should make is a person to help you.”

 

“Yes. I doubt that you will always be here to help me.”

 

“Oh, I will be leaving very soon. Back to the heavens.”

 

“Then create a monster with intelligence. I have knowledge of the other world, but none of this one.”

 

The previous world. That had also been a world of swords and sorcery, but there were no Demon Lords there. Magic was not so easy to use, and you could not create monsters there.

 

I was a lord over there, and I felt that must have been researching something to do with opening portals to other worlds.

 

I remember being involved in some accident while researching a country called ‘Japan,’ but my memories end there.

 

And so I had retained knowledge from the old world and this place called Japan, but my knowledge of this world was close to zero.

 

“I understand. Then the first creation will prioritize knowledge. Do you have any preferences in terms of appearance?”

 

“No.”

 

“That was blunt. Fine, I will decide.”

 

She said, then added, ‘I’ll make a girl then.’

 

A girl sounded too weak to me, but I had already declared a lack of preference, and so I would not ask for a modification. After all, the monster that was to be created would be a private secretary type, who was intelligent. Strength was not necessary.

 

The Goddess said, ‘excuse me,’ and plucked out some of my hairs.

 

She dropped those hairs into a pot.

 

“I’ll be creating the monster here, but when it is your turn later on, just will it and allow your magic to flow in.”

 

“Does the strength of the monster depend on the strength of the magic?”

 

“Generally speaking, yes. But it is not that simple. And luck is involved as well.”

 

After she said this, the pot began to glow.

It seemed that the monster was about to be born.

 

“Statuses are not visible in this world. But there are exceptions. You can see them when they are born, and when you use a ‘Disclosure’ spell.”

 

“How convenient.”

 

“You will be able to see their rank, fighting ability, and main skills. But you cannot see the statuses of Demon Kings and advanced classes and other special beings.”

 

The Goddess warned, and then smoke began to rise from the pot. Numbers and letters were projected onto the smoke.

 

“It will be displayed now.”

 

I looked at the letters and numbers.

 

Name: None

Rarity: Legend Rare ☆☆☆☆☆

Race: Monster

Job: Demon King’s Secretary

Fighting Ability: 121

Skills: Secretary, Maid, Knowledge, Loyalty, Aid, Strategy, Politics

 

As soon as the words ‘Rarity’ popped up, the Goddess started to jump with joy.

 

“It’s a Legend Rare! You hit the jackpot with this one.”

 

She said in pure bliss.

Apparently, the monster that was about to come out was incredibly rare.

 

I supposed it was a good thing, but I did not get very excited. Instead, I stood and waited for this secretary to materialize into this world.
